**Mgmt Meeting Minutes — Retiring the Brightline Range**

Quick recap for sales leads at Fenholt Supplies: we agreed to retire the Brightline fixture range by year-end. Remaining stock moves to clearance pricing next month, and accounts on standing orders get migrated to the Lumetta range. Trade-in incentives were approved in principle. The confidential note on next steps sits just below.

board note of bajof-bajeg: The pricing group signed off on a budget of $13.4 million for Project Sildor. The renewal with Lamixek Holdings closes at $48.9 million a year, 49 percent above the last contract.

## Runbook: sort stability in Gridloom report builder

Quick context for review: sorting used to be non-deterministic on tied keys, which let users infer row insertion timing — mildly leaky, now fixed. We append a salted tiebreaker column server-side, so output order is stable and opaque. Nothing sensitive ends up in query logs; the salt rotates weekly. If ordering flips between runs, the salt job probably stalled. The relevant settings are as follows.

config for kajog-tadug:
[casax]
port = 11211
region = west-3
host = casax.nelvroworks.internal
timeout_ms = 5000
retries = 7

Changed defaults in Splitfork, our assignment service. Bucketing now uses sticky hashing per account instead of per session, and the holdout slice grew from 2% to 5%. Callers relying on session-level reassignment must opt in explicitly. Review the diff against the new baseline; the updated default configuration is listed below.

config for tagep-kajof:
[casir]
port = 6379
region = south-1
host = casir.paliqdyn.example
team = tamax
timeout_ms = 250
retries = 2